What is Codeine and How is it Regulated?
Codeine is an opiate medication utilized to deal with mild to moderate pain, serious coughing, and diarrhea. Because it is an opioid derivative, it brings a capacity for dependence and abuse. As a result, federal governments worldwide strictly manage its distribution.
In Italy, the Ministry of Health (Ministero della Salute) and the Italian Medicines Agency (Agenzia Italiana del Farmaco - AIFA) manage pharmaceutical laws. The guidelines concerning codeine are rigid, developed to balance patient access to needed pain relief with public health security.

Traveling to Italy with Codeine
For travelers already prescribed codeine for a genuine medical condition, bringing the medication into Italy requires careful preparation to avoid legal complications at customizeds.
Best Practices for Traveling with Opioids:
- Carry a Doctor's Note: Bring an official letter from the prescribing physician detailing the medical condition, the need of the medication, and the exact dosage.
- Keep Original Packaging: Keep medications in their initial drug store packaging with the prescription label clearly noticeable.
- Examine Quantity Limits: Only bring an affordable supply for the period of the journey (typically no more than a 30-day supply).
- Declare if Necessary: For big quantities or uncommon formulas, examine current Italian customizeds guidelines before departure.
Alternatives to Codeine Available in Italy
If a client is experiencing pain or a cough while in Italy and can not-- or chooses not to-- go through the process of getting a narcotic prescription, several effective alternatives are commonly readily available:
-
For Pain Management:
- Ibuprofen (Ibuprofene): Available in numerous strengths; lower dosages can be purchased OTC.
- Paracetamol (Paracetamolo/ Tachipirina): The most typical first-line analgesic and antipyretic, commonly offered OTC.
- Ketoprofen (Ketoprofene): Often utilized for musculoskeletal discomfort, available in both OTC and prescription strengths.
-
For Cough Suppression:
- Dextromethorphan: A typical non-opioid cough suppressant discovered in different OTC syrups.
- Levodropropizine: A commonly used peripheral antitussive offered in Italy that does not cause main nerve system sedation.
